About the Book

Scarborough's "Greatest Generation" is a tribute to the Scarborough, Maine, residents who answered the call to duty during World War Two. It consists of twenty-five interviews with World War Two veterans who describe some of their wartime experiences. Based on interviews at the American Legion Libby Mitchell post 76, it tells the stories of bravery and duty of many of the Scarborough Veterans of World War Two.
